ROSECRANS, Mo. - U.S. Air Force Senior Airman Steven Sirois (left) and Tech. Sgt. Taylor Schoen, assigned to the 180th Airlift Squadron, Missouri Air National Guard, throw signal smoke to mark a dropzone during Survival Evasion Resistance and Escape (SERE) training at Rosecrans Air National Guard Base, St. Joseph, Mo., Sept. 29, 2016. SERE training is required for all aircrew to equip them with survival techniques necessary in the event of an emergency. (U.S. Air Force photo by Senior Airman Patrick P. Evenson)
